Ingredients  
8 lbs pork shoulder (with skin on)
salt and pepper
cloves of garlic

COOKING INSTRUCTIONS 
1. Preheat oven to  425F.
2. Wash meat with  water and pat dry with paper towels.
3. Sprinkle with  salt and pepper (enough to coat the entire meat once).
4. Make a few slits  on the meat and insert garlic.
